Translator App
‘Say Hi’ is a translator app which can be downloaded for free from Amazon on to any phone/tablet for use during phonecalls where one or both people do not speak the same language. It translates as the person speaking speaks. Here is the link to download it: https://www.sayhi.com/en/translate/

6J at Beech’s Base
Today at Beech’s Base 6J visited. Our theme was ‘Fairtrade’ linked to geographical work in class. We explored the how this began and why. The children made Rice Krispie cakes which linked to Fairtrade chocolate. As part of the topic the children roleplayed a trading style game and thoroughly enjoyed it 🙂
